O’Shaughnessy: Stocks The Place To Be Over Next Several Years

Author and money manager James O’Shaughnessy says that the Federal Reserve’s recent increase of the Discount Rate was “not a big deal”, and that he’s still very bullish on stocks over the longer term. O’Shaughnessy tells CNBC that he thinks factors are in place that will make stocks the “asset class of the choice” over the next three to five years.
